11.5.3 Tag Identification System
iButton® tags can be installed at sampling sites
to simplify data logging. Tags have a unique
serial number and a user-entered alphanumeric
tag identifier. When the matching connector on the meter contacts the tag,
logged measurements are labeled with the tag serial number and tag
identifier. Tag configuration is accessed through the Log menu.
Read tag
• Select the “Read tag” option to view and modify the information associated
with tag, or to insert new tag IDs.
• The display shows the message “Touch the tag with the tag reader”. Touch the
tag with the tag reader located on the top of the meter.
• When the tag is detected the meter displays the tag serial number and ID (if
available).
• Press <Tag ID> to insert a new ID (available only if the tag has not been
previously identified) .
• Press <Modify> to change the tag identifier or <OK> to close the window.
